A quick and easy grilled corn recipe slathered with a zesty cilantro lime butter that brings smoky, buttery, and fresh citrus flavors together for the perfect summer BBQ side dish.
Butter can be prepared up to 2 days ahead and refrigerated; bring to room temperature before use. To prevent drying out, wrap corn loosely in foil for first 5-6 minutes on grill, then unwrap to finish charring. Turn corn every 2-3 minutes to avoid burning and achieve even char. Fresh lime juice is preferred over bottled for best flavor. Vegan butter can be used for dairy-free version. Optional additions include sm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, or crumbled cotija cheese for variations.
